Meaning and Origin
Steffenie is a feminine name of Greek origin, derived from the word "Stephanos," meaning "crown." This name, therefore, carries with it the imagery of royalty and authority. It shares its roots with the more familiar name "Stephanie," further reinforcing its association with strength and power. While both names have a similar origin and meaning, Steffenie's less common spelling sets it apart, offering a unique and distinctive alternative.
Pronunciation and Spelling
Steffenie is pronounced "STEF-uh-nee," with the emphasis on the first syllable. Its spelling is straightforward and generally easy to understand, although some might initially mispronounce it as "Stef-FIN-ee." Nickname Choices
Steffenie offers a variety of nickname options, allowing for personalization and flexibility. Popular choices include "Steffie," "Fennie," and "Steph." These nicknames add a touch of informality and endearment, making them suitable for close friends and family.

Variation and Similar Names
Steffenie has several variations, including "Steffanie," "Stefanie," and "Steffani." It also shares phonetic elements with names like "Stephanie," "Stefania," and "Stefanella," offering a range of choices for parents seeking similar sounds.
